    As a German - a lot of our neighbours have significantly better rail. For some of them, delayed trains from Germany are a large cause of delay.

    I like our train system, and use it a lot, but there is very significant room for improvement. According to the current statistic, 40% of long distance trains are late.

    A lot of problems come from the half-aborted privatisation. The railway was turned into a public company, but the stock was never sold, so it’s owned by the state, but still a AG (plc?) that tries to run a profit.
